IronClaw vs Hermes Agent

Enterprise zero-trust at $750/seat/year against open-source sandbox-by-default.

Side-by-side

AxisIronClawHermes Agent
Setup timeMulti-day setup with vendor onboarding. Expected.5–8 minutes solo.
Security modelgVisor sandbox. Hash-chained immutable audit log. RBAC + SAML SSO. Air-gap mode.Docker sandbox + approval flow. Sufficient for most non-regulated cases.
Model supportMulti-LLM with vendor support contracts.Multi-LLM with community support.
Cost$750/seat/year minimum + ops.$10/mo VPS + free.
EcosystemVendor-curated plugin set.Open ecosystem.
Best forFinance, healthcare, government, regulated industries.Everyone else.

Verdict

Different markets entirely. IronClaw exists because regulated buyers can't run open-source agents without a vendor on the hook. Don't compare these on price.

Notes

  • Source-available license forbids competitive products. Read the license.
  • Vendor-supported audit logs may be a hard compliance requirement; verify before assuming Hermes can be configured to match.
  • If your CISO has heard of one of these, it's IronClaw.
